Meta Interview Question

Question: Consolidate time for each function. /* Function stage(start/ends) time(start/end) main start 0 <----------- main running foo start 3 foo end 7 <----------- main running zoo start 10 zoo end 13 <-------------- main running moo start 15 foo start 17 foo end 18 <---------------- moo running moo end 20 < --------------main running main end 22 Consolidate time for each function. */

class LogInfo { String functionName; String timeType; int time; LogInfo(String functionName, String timeType, int time) { this.functionName = functionName; this.timeType = timeType; this.time = time; } } class LogOfStack { String functionName; int startime; int totalTime; LogOfStack(String functionName, int startime, int totalTime) { this.functionName = functionName; this.startime = startime; this.totalTime = totalTime; } } public Map consolidation(List logInfos) { final Map map = new HashMap(); final Stack activeStack = new Stack(); for (final LogInfo info : logInfos) { if (info.timeType.equals("start")) { if (!activeStack.isEmpty()) { final LogOfStack previous = activeStack.peek(); previous.totalTime = previous.totalTime + info.time - previous.startime; previous.startime = info.time; } activeStack.push(new LogOfStack(info.functionName, info.time, 0)); } else { LogOfStack previous = activeStack.pop(); previous.totalTime = previous.totalTime + info.time - previous.startime; if (!map.containsKey(info.functionName)) { map.put(info.functionName, 0); } final int time = map.get(info.functionName) + previous.totalTime; map.put(info.functionName, time); if (!activeStack.isEmpty()) { previous = activeStack.peek(); previous.startime = info.time; } } } return map; } public static void main(String[] arg) { Facebook facebook = new Facebook(); String main = "main"; String foo = "foo"; String zoo = "zoo"; String moo = "moo"; String pee = "pee"; List logInfos = new ArrayList(); logInfos.add(facebook.new LogInfo(main, "start", 0)); logInfos.add(facebook.new LogInfo(foo, "start", 3)); logInfos.add(facebook.new LogInfo(foo, "end", 7)); logInfos.add(facebook.new LogInfo(zoo, "start", 10)); logInfos.add(facebook.new LogInfo(zoo, "end", 13)); logInfos.add(facebook.new LogInfo(moo, "start", 15)); logInfos.add(facebook.new LogInfo(foo, "start", 16)); logInfos.add(facebook.new LogInfo(pee, "start", 17)); logInfos.add(facebook.new LogInfo(pee, "end", 18)); logInfos.add(facebook.new LogInfo(foo, "end", 18)); logInfos.add(facebook.new LogInfo(moo, "end", 20)); logInfos.add(facebook.new LogInfo(main, "end", 22)); System.out.println(facebook.consolidation(logInfos)); } }
